Transaction d91dfb0196e633ae31240a59c242c873532361ec5286f76f5e837637b66bf303

2 Input
2 Outputs
  • d91dfb0196e633ae31240a59c242c873532361ec5286f76f5e837637b66bf303:0
  • value  273478
    address  36SxESDEMAmsU1meWDKtWYRhTWVPc5PLd3
  • d91dfb0196e633ae31240a59c242c873532361ec5286f76f5e837637b66bf303:1
  • value  168446
    address  1DKfKtCnWtpxgp2GTZFwTKvjPHCKo5aLeK